For a Civil Engineer living in Kolkata, managing monthly expenses with a salary of ₹50,000 is quite feasible. The estimated cost of living is approximately ₹28,050, offering potential savings of ₹21,950 per month.
Major expense components include rent (₹14,000), groceries (₹4,800), utilities (₹1,900), and transport (₹1,400). Additionally, you may spend on dining (₹2,600), internet (₹750), entertainment (₹1,100), and miscellaneous needs (₹1,500).
In terms of food and grocery essentials, Kolkata offers a variety of options. A basic lunch near work typically costs around ₹153, and a mid-range dinner for two is around ₹890. Common items like milk (₹55), bread (₹59), and eggs (₹97) are reasonably priced.
For protein sources, chicken costs about ₹250 per kilogram, while rice is around ₹87. Fresh fruits and vegetables average ₹117 and ₹71 respectively per kg.
